Transaction 57b505ef491c9cce691b24cde8e02ecf67e599abc1180b4b17da2a44763efaca
1 Input
1 Output
-
57b505ef491c9cce691b24cde8e02ecf67e599abc1180b4b17da2a44763efaca:0
- value
- 1492592
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75e2fa677938c817996a4e29602882af1872b91a OP_EQUAL
- address
- 3CSLtht5UMAvp7FExivvbtxjckFAJHooTH